Smart Placement & Fabric Considerations
Like any strong cross stitch pattern, the Xmas Cupcake Cross Stitch Pattern PDF rewards thoughtful execution—not just enthusiasm. Here’s where attention matters most:
- Small lettering & fine details: The cupcake wrappers include subtle texture lines and tiny holly berries. These hold up beautifully on smooth Aida or linen—but test on scrap fabric first if planning embroidery on textured baby knit or terry cloth.
- Fabric texture & weight: Avoid dense, highly textured towels or stretchy baby onesies unless using light stabilizer and low-tension stitching. The design shines best on stable, medium-weight woven fabrics like cotton-linen blends, quilting cotton, or tea towels.
- Dark fabric: The black-and-white symbol chart assumes standard contrast. If stitching on navy, charcoal, or burgundy fabric, verify thread color contrast—some light floss shades may fade visually. Always compare light/dark fabric mockups before finalizing a listing.
- Curved surfaces & seams: Not ideal for curved mugs or rounded tote straps. Stick to flat panels: pillow fronts, blanket corners, towel hems, or apron pockets.
- Frequent washing: While cross stitch holds up well, recommend hand-washing or gentle cycles for finished products—especially baby embroidery or embroidered towels meant for daily use.

Practical Embroidery Notes Before You Stitch
Before adding the Xmas Cupcake Cross Stitch Pattern PDF to your next batch of custom embroidery projects, run through these quick checks:
- Test on scrap fabric—especially if pairing with new thread brands or unfamiliar stabilizers.
- Confirm hoop size compatibility. Though unstated in the file list, review the pattern dimensions in the mockup to ensure it fits comfortably within your standard hoops (common sizes: 4”, 5”, or 6”).
- Assess stitch density visually: areas like cupcake swirls and bow loops are moderately detailed—not ultra-dense—so they’ll work well on medium-count fabric without puckering.
- Use appropriate stabilizer—light cutaway or tear-away works best for cotton towels and pillow covers; avoid heavy fusibles on delicate baby items.
- Check small details post-stitching: those holly berries and wrapper lines should pop clearly. If they blur, adjust thread tension or try a finer needle.
- Verify commercial licensing before selling finished products. Since this is listed under Cross Stitch Patterns and Graphics, confirm terms directly with the designer or platform—never assume resale rights.
